Rosie O’Donnell To Be Cast As Elizabeth Edwards?
(HMG) – In what is a rather…um, interesting casting choice, ‘Game Change’ Mark Halperin has said that he pictures Rosie O’Donnell as playing Elizabeth Edwards in the possible HBO special based on the bestselling political breakout hit.
Not only that, but he made a rather amusing suggestion for Sarah Palin’s character:
“Palin could play herself. It seems she’s willing to do almost anything for money. It would be great stunt-casting,” he joked.
‘Game Change’ is the newest bestseller based on the Obama/McCain election, and the fight up to it.
The book offers intense reenactments and in depth dialogue and conversation from behind the scenes, as given from an incredible 300 political operatives from the scene.
So far none of the information given has been disputed, and the book has been hailed as a fantastic look into what was a controversial, heated, and groundbreaking election for U.S. history.
Many of the characters in this real-life drama, which had been bought by HBO, do not come off well.
For example, Elizabeth Edwards is made out to be a shrill, difficult and arrogant woman.
The Clintons are made out to be out and out deceivers.
“Everybody in politics lies, but [the Clintons] do it with such ease it’s troubling,” David Geffen, who was once a loyal supporter of the Clintons, said.
